摘要
Stimulated Brillouin scattering (SBS) is the primary factor that limits the output power in narrow-linewidth high power fiber amplifiers. We propose and demonstrate a novel method for the suppression of SBS in optical fibers using a tilted fiber Bragg grating (TFBG) for the first time. An obvious decrease in backward Stokes power and increase in threshold could be observed with TFBG insert. Experiment results demonstrated that a more satisfying suppression could be achieved with improved TFBG, which provides a good reference for the future power scaling of high power narrow bandwidth all-fiber amplifiers.
